Stephen Mulrooney


Stephen J. Mulrooney is a former Canadian politician who was elected to the Newfoundland and [Labrador House of Assembly] in the 1975 [Newfoundland general election|1975 provincial election]. He represented the electoral district of Exploits as a member of the Liberal [Party of Newfoundland and Labrador]. He beat Progressive Conservative Hugh Twomey by nine votes, and the election results were later challenged in court and nullified. Twomey then defeated Mulooney in the ensuing by-election with 2,848 votes to Mulrooney's 2,197.
